[0009]The present invention specifically addresses and alleviates the above-identified deficiencies in the art. In this regard, the present invention is directed to a system and method that can enable a participant to remotely play in an actual casino card game, such as Blackjack, Poker, Texas Hold 'Em, and any other card game that is known and/or later developed. According to a preferred embodiment, the invention incorporates the use of a card playing station that is either integrated with or interconnectable to a conventional card playing table. The card playing station will be operatively configured to establish a secure communications link with a computer associated with the participant, which will typically comprise a personal computer or the like, and thus enable the participant to interact with the card playing station. With respect to the latter, the same will further preferably be provided with web cams and the like to thus enable the participant to readily view the casino environment and interact directly with a live dealer and other card players. Along these lines, it is contemplated that multiple web cams or the like will be provided to thus enable the participant to choose, at his or her option, various angles or perspectives throughout the casino. In this regard, one aspect of the invention is to provide the remote participant with the ability to experience a live card game in virtually any type of casino of the participant's choosing, whether it be in Las Vegas, Monte Carlo, Atlantic City, or the like.

Problems solved by technology

Problematic with the former option is that it requires the would-be participant to actually be physically present in a casino, which is often impractical or impossible.
This is especially true given the highly regulated nature of the gaming industry, which typically provides for very limited zoning where casinos can lawfully operate.

Abstract

A system and method for enabling an individual to remotely participate in an actual casino card game, such as Poker, Blackjack and the like. A card playing station is provided that is integrated or interconnected with a conventional card table that is capable of being operatively interconnected to a remote computer via a secure, preferably web-based communications link. The card playing station is provided with means such as web cams to view the casino environment and enable the participant to remotely interact with the dealer and other players. The card playing station is further provided with means for receiving, reading and discharging playing cards, as well as waging bets and tallying gains and/or losses. The systems and methods thus enable the participant to actually play in a conventional casino-style environment and further afford the participant the opportunity to participate in gaming in virtually any casino throughout the world.

Description

CROSS-REFERENCE TO RELATED APPLICATIONS[0001]Not ApplicableSTATEMENT RE: FEDERALLY SPONSORED RESEARCH / DEVELOPMENT[0002]Not ApplicableBACKGROUND[0003]The present invention is directed to systems and methods for enabling remote participation in a casino-type card game, such as Blackjack or Poker, in a casino environment.[0004]Gaming and gambling, and in particular casino-style games, have, been dramatically increasing in popularity in both the United States and internationally. In this regard, many states, and countries expanded legalized gaming, as exemplified by an explosion in the opening of Native American casinos in the United States. There has likewise been an exponential increase in on-line gaming and gambling.[0005]Among the most well-known of the casino-style games include card games such as Blackjack, Poker and Texas Hold 'Em.
